    Costco, Morris IL. Picked up my load last night at 10pm; I really should've been there earlier but ran into issues with my previous final. Right off the bat, noticed my trailer didn't have mud flaps. Before looking for the onsite maintenance, I rolled over the scale and was a good 1,000+ over gross. Culprit looked like it was the hefty amount of snow residing on the top of my trailer. Costco had a snow removal machine installed the other week, but it was already broken. Ran down maintenance to get the mud flaps fixed, and then called after hours who sent me to on-road??

    I ran out my 14 just making to my pickup. So after getting the run-around from after hours, and having maintenance tell me that some guys shovel the snow off the trailer themselves, that I figured I'd might as well wait till my DL gets in in the morning. I'm not going anywhere.

    Then em this morning I got conflicting information on where to go to have the snow taken care of. Finally, the FM told me to go to a wash out 20 miles away. Out of route. I wonder if I'm going to be paid for that. When I got there, there were 3 Swift trucks ahead of me. And when I finally left, there were 10 of them in line. As I'm leaving, the wash people tell me that the roof of my trailer is bowed in pretty significantly.

    I called claims to report the bowed in roof. Stopped at the pilot exit 93 to make sure it was the snow causing me to be overweight. And finally back to the costco to have swift look at the roof and make sure it was acceptable. It was.

    As they are filling out the paperwork, because they also fixed a small air leak, we noticed that one of my identification lights on the rear of the trailer had gone out. Razzlefrazzle. F. F. F. Because it's welded to the frame, they estimated up to two hours to fix it. Oh, I was suppose to be in Dayton, OH, at 4pm today. I might be able to squeeze in shutting down at them tonight, maybe. If not, I'll just get as close as I can for a 10.

    This has been a pretty good trailer from hell. Also, comparing before/after weights, it seemed I had 4500 pounds of snow on the trailer.
